Q: Is 1,985,379 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 1,985,379 is a composite number.

Why is 1,985,379 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 1,985,379 can be evenly divided by 1 3 11 17 33 51 187 561 3,539 10,617 38,929 60,163 116,787 180,489 661,793 and 1,985,379, with no remainder.

Since 1,985,379 cannot be divided by just 1 and 1,985,379, it is a composite number.
